WebOct 21, 2024 · A small supplier is a business that has taxable revenue under $30,000 for four consecutive quarters. Once a business has passed $30,000 in revenue, it has exceeded the small supplier threshold and must register for GST/HST collection and remittance. WebThe person ceases to be a small supplier immediately before the consideration becomes due or is paid for the particular taxable supply that puts the person over the $30,000 or $50,000 small supplier threshold. 5. These threshold amounts (i.e., $30,000 or $50,000) are greater in certain situations.
